About the Item
Mariano Sigüenza y Ortiz was a Spanish painter and engraver born in Valencia.
This copper painter and engraver was a disciple of the Academy of Fine Arts of San Carlos, in the early years of the 19th century. It is known that he came from a family dedicated to the art of silk making, so it is not surprising that he began his training at the Academy of San Carlos with the intention of applying his knowledge to this field. However, it seems that he opted for painting and later for intaglio engraving. Of his production as a painter, a copy of the painting La Virgen con el Niño y San Juan Bautista, the work of Mengs, and Los santos penitentes Pablo y Antonio, for which he obtained the 17 January 1836 a Supernumerary Academic position, for painting.
Later, he devoted himself exclusively to the exercise of copper engraving. As an engraver, he illustrated the Biographical Dictionary, by Oliva, and the History of Spain, by Father Mariana. The engraving of El Niño Jesús, a copy of Murillo's painting, earned him the appointment as academic of merit, in the engraving class, of the Academy of San Carlos. From that moment on, he was linked as a teacher to the academic institution, of which he became director of the School of Engraving. According to Ossorio y Boix, deprived of this position, later, due to political problems, he dedicated himself to painting, to cover "his most urgent needs" by performing some devotional themes, until ruined and ill, "his reason was obscured", he died. at the Benevolent establishment in 1860, after spending the last years of his life begging from door to door.

Nicolaes Pieterszoon Berchem (1 October 1620 – 18 February 1683) was a highly esteemed and prolific Dutch Golden Age painter of pastoral landscapes, populated with mythological or biblical figures, but also of a number of allegories and genre pieces.
He was a member of the second generation of "Dutch Italianate landscape" painters. These were artists who travelled to Italy, or aspired to, in order to soak up the romanticism of the country, bringing home sketchbooks full of drawings of classical ruins and pastoral imagery. His paintings, of which he produced an immense number, (Hofstede de Groot claimed around 850, although many are misattributed), were in great demand, as were his 80 etchings and 500 drawings.
